    5 Tips for Staying Compliant

    As a business grows, you need to be sure you are following compliance. Each state has its own set of employment and business laws and regulations that companies need to abide by. Failing to conduct compliant business can result in fines and penalties. Here are five tips for staying compliant in business.

    1. Decide on a Business Structure

    If you are deciding to start a business, its essential to be prepared. You need to determine the structure of your business before you can decide whether or not you qualify for a small business loan. There are different categories for classifying your business, such as Doing Business As (DBA), Corporation or an LLC you need to research to see which offers the best benefits and is the best fit for your business structure.

    2. Register Business & Obtain Business License

    Research online on how to register your business for the state that you are in because each state has different guidelines that small business owners must follow. After you register your business name, you must obtain a business license and permit so that you can legally do business in the city your business is in. You’ll need to research requirements for the specific city you live in to make sure you are compliant.

    3. Stay Up to Date on Laws

    A business must have its procedures and policies in place, but you also must be diligent in keeping up to date with changing laws to ensure you are compliant. Laws frequently vary, so a business needs to be up to date to ensure no legal problems, penalties, or fines.

    4. Keep Important Contacts List Updated

    It’s essential to keep your essential contacts up to date and easily accessible, so that should any issues arise, yourself or employees can make the needed calls to handle matters.

    5. Outsource to Experts

    If staying compliant seems very overwhelming, consider outsourcing to experts, such as PEO companies who hire specialists who are up to date and knowledgeable in the area of compliance. A PEO company will review your policies and procedures to ensure compliance and can handle other areas such as HR and payroll, to make sure your business is staying compliant.

    What is a PEO Company?

    PEO, also referred to as a Professional Employer Organization, is a company that will work with your business to provide human resource services and expertise that a business owner may not be able to provide alone. Employers are hiring a PEO for HR support, shared employment liability, and to gain improved benefits packages for employees. The scope of PEO companies’ services can vary, but most handle health benefits, workers’ compensation plans, unemployment insurance claims, payroll processing, and tax compliance, and human resources policies and practices. PEO companies can also offer more specialized services, such as employee training and development, international partnerships, and risk management.

    Start-ups, small businesses, and not for profits are usually not experienced in matters of HR, especially with the changing federal, state, and local compliance regulations. PEO companies have specialists who are experts in compliance and can advise your business in this area to ensure you are remaining compliant in your business dealings. A PEO company helps small businesses, start-ups, or not-for-profit guidance from any missteps to avoid any costly penalties that can be fined when regulations are misunderstood and not being appropriately followed.

    PEO companies are outsourced from all industries and businesses, including accounting, tech companies, doctors, retailers, engineers, mechanics, and plumbers. A PEO company has many services that can help your business with its mission and values, remain compliant, and create a healthy work environment.
